Cerebras Systems made a splash in public markets this week, with its blockbuster debut underscoring that the artificial intelligence infrastructure buildout continues to attract strong investor appetite. The IPO comes amid heightened demand for specialized computing hardware, suggesting the sector’s expansion may have further room to run.

Live News

Cerebras, a designer of wafer-scale AI chips, went public recently to widespread market enthusiasm. According to a report from Fortune, the company’s debut ranks among the most notable technology IPOs of the year, reflecting sustained confidence in the AI hardware ecosystem. The listing follows a period of intense capital deployment by cloud giants and enterprises racing to build out generative AI capabilities. The successful float suggests that investors remain willing to back companies that provide the physical infrastructure—chips, networking, and cooling systems—needed to train and run large language models. Cerebras’ proprietary architecture, which uses a single massive chip rather than linking many smaller ones, has carved out a niche in the market. While larger competitors like NVIDIA dominate the landscape, Cerebras’ technology has attracted customers in research, government, and energy sectors. Market participants noted that the IPO’s reception could serve as a barometer for other specialized AI hardware firms considering public listings. The offering was reportedly oversubscribed, with strong demand from both institutional and retail investors. However, the broader market backdrop remains mixed, as concerns about elevated valuations and potential overcapacity in data center buildout persist. Still, the immediate success of Cerebras’ debut may indicate that the current wave of AI infrastructure investment is far from its peak. Expert Insights

From an investment perspective, Cerebras’ successful debut reinforces the narrative that AI infrastructure remains a high-conviction area for capital allocation. But caution is warranted. The IPO pricing environment has been volatile, and the long-term profitability of standalone AI hardware firms is still unproven. Companies in this space must demonstrate consistent revenue growth and customer diversification to justify current valuations. Analysts point out that while Cerebras has carved a defensible niche, it faces formidable competition from established semiconductor giants and the potential commoditization of AI compute. The company’s ability to expand beyond its current customer base will be critical. Moreover, the broader AI market could experience a shakeout if spending growth decelerates. For now, the IPO’s reception suggests that the market believes the AI infrastructure cycle still has legs. But investors should monitor quarterly results and capital expenditure guidance from major cloud providers as leading indicators. Any slowdown in hyperscaler spending would likely pressure the entire hardware ecosystem. Overall, Cerebras’ blockbuster debut may be a point of optimism, but disciplined selection remains essential in this rapidly evolving sector.
